Ginger L. Graham
Overview
Ms. Graham has served as a director since November 2005 and currently serves on the Finance Committee. Ms. Graham was our Chief Executive Officer from September 2003 to March 2007 and also served as our President from September 2003 to June 2006. Prior to joining Amylin, Ms. Graham held various positions with Guidant Corporation, including Group Chairman, Office of the President; and President of the Vascular Intervention Group and Vice President. Ms. Graham held various positions with Eli Lilly and Company from 1979 to 1992 including sales, marketing, finance and strategic planning positions. She serves on the board of directors of the American Diabetes Research Foundation Board, Proteus Biomedical Pharmaceutical Systems Division, ICAT Managers, the California Council on Science and Technology, the Harvard Business School Health Industry Advisory Board, the Harvard Business School Dean's Advisory Board, the Advisory Board for the Kellogg Center for Executive Women, and the University of California, San Diego Health Sciences Advisory Board. Ms. Graham received an M.B.A. from Harvard University.
